What a Chafing Dish Actually Does
A chafing dish is a portable holding system that keeps cooked food at safe serving temperature for hours without continuing to cook it. Every chafer follows the same simple architecture: a frame holds a water pan; the water pan sits over a heat source (fuel, electric, or induction); a food pan nests inside the water pan; a lid traps steam and moisture. The water turns to gentle steam. The steam warms the food pan. The food pan holds your dish at temperature. This indirect-heat method is called a bain-marie, and it's the reason the last guest in line gets food that tastes the same as the first.
Components at a Glance
- Frame or stand: the structural backbone. Look for stable, non-wobbling construction. Stackable frames save serious storage space for caterers transporting multiple units.
- Water pan: the deep bottom pan that holds hot water. The engine of the whole system.
- Food pan: the shallower top pan that holds your dish. Keep extras on hand so you can swap a fresh full pan onto the buffet line during service without missing a beat.
- Lid: traps heat and moisture. Critical for hygiene (blocks airborne contaminants) and food quality (prevents drying).
- Heat source: fuel canister, electric element, or induction coil. Each has trade-offs covered below.
The "Hold, Don't Cook" Rule
The most common mistake new operators make is treating a chafer like a portable stove. Chafing dishes are designed for holding food, not cooking it. Their job is to maintain the temperature of food that's already been brought to its safe internal temperature in your kitchen — usually 165°F for poultry, 145°F for whole cuts of beef and pork, 155°F for ground meats. Once the food is in the chafer, the goal is to hold it above 140°F until the last guest is served.
Why this matters: the temperature "danger zone" runs from 40°F to 140°F. Bacteria multiply rapidly inside that window. Reheating cold food in a chafer takes far too long and parks the food inside the danger zone — a textbook food-safety violation. Always temp food before it hits the buffet line, and use a thermometer to spot-check every 30 minutes during long events. The 1 to 1.25-Inch Water Rule
Water level is the single most overlooked variable on a buffet line. Get it wrong and you'll either scorch your pans or soggy out your food.
The rule is simple: maintain water depth between 1 inch and 1.25 inches in the water pan. Too little water and the pan runs dry, the heat bakes residue into the metal, and you've got "burn-on" that's nearly impossible to remove with standard detergents. Too much water and the surface touches the bottom of the food pan, transferring direct boiling heat that turns crisp vegetables into mush and breaks delicate sauces.
Always start with hot or boiling water. Cold water forces your fuel to work overtime just to heat the water itself before it can warm the food pan. You waste 20 to 30 minutes and burn through canisters faster. Hot water from the start gets steam moving in under five minutes.
Check the water level every 45 to 60 minutes during long events. Top off with hot water — never cold — to maintain steam without dropping the food pan temperature.
Heat Sources Compared
Your heat choice depends entirely on venue access and event length.
| Heat Source | Best For | Burn Time | Heat Control | Cost Profile |
|---|---|---|---|---|
| Canned fuel (Sterno, gel) | Outdoor events, off-grid venues, vineyards, warehouses | 2-3 hours | Basic (open / half / closed snuffer) | Low upfront, recurring canister cost |
| Wick fuel | Long indoor events needing steady burn | Up to 6 hours | Basic | Mid upfront, recurring canister cost |
| Butane burners | Mid-range indoor/outdoor with refillable preference | Refillable | Adjustable flame intensity | Higher upfront, lower per-event |
| Electric | Indoor venues with outlets, long buffets | Continuous | Precise thermostat | Higher upfront, no fuel cost |
| Induction | High-end indoor catering, fire-restricted venues | Continuous | Precise digital control | Highest upfront, lowest operating |
Fuel Realities for Off-Grid Catering
Canned heat is the lifeblood of outdoor service. Open flames require constant monitoring — wind guards aren't optional for outdoor events. A light breeze will blow out your flame or dissipate heat fast enough that the water pan never gets to steaming temperature, and your buffet drops below safe holding inside an hour. Always carry at least one extra set of fuel canisters per chafer. Nothing kills a buffet faster than a dish dropping out of temp because the fuel ran out mid-service.
The Electric and Induction ROI
If you have access to power, electric and induction-ready chafers eliminate the chemical smell some fuel gels leave behind, remove fire risk, and give you precise temperature control. Higher upfront cost is offset by zero recurring fuel spend and lower insurance exposure. For venue-based caterers running multiple events per week, induction pays back inside the first year.
304 vs 400-Series Stainless Steel
When you compare price points across brands, the secret is usually in the steel grade.
Type 304 stainless steel contains higher nickel and chromium content than cheaper 400-series alloys. In the high-moisture environment of a steam table, 400-series steel will eventually pit and rust. Type 304 is non-porous, corrosion-resistant, and stands up to commercial dishwashers and the constant heat-cool cycle without warping. It's the standard for any chafer you plan to keep more than two seasons.
How to tell: feel the weight. A well-made 304 chafer feels solid in your hand. The lid closes with a deliberate weight. Cheap 400-series chafers feel thin and tinny. Reinforced corners and welded edges are also signals of commercial-grade construction — flimsy spot-welds are the first thing to fail under repeated use.
Sizes and Capacity
Chafing dishes follow the same standardized hotel-pan sizing system as the rest of your back-of-house equipment, which is what lets you mix and match across steam tables, prep stations, and transport carriers.
| Size | Pan Dimensions | Capacity | Best For |
|---|---|---|---|
| Full size | ~12 x 20 inches | 8-9 quarts | Main entrees, large gatherings, signature dishes (pulled pork, lasagna, casseroles) |
| 2/3 size | ~14 x 12 inches | 5-6 quarts | Mid-volume mains, secondary entrees |
| Half size | ~10 x 12 inches | 4-5 quarts | Side dishes, sauces, smaller batches |
| Third size | ~6 x 12 inches | 2-3 quarts | Toppings, condiments, accent items |
Pan Depth Matters Too
Depths typically run 2.5 to 6 inches. A 2.5-inch shallow pan is ideal for items that need to brown evenly — roasted vegetables, chicken pieces. Deeper 4 to 6-inch pans handle liquids: soups, stews, saucy pasta dishes, mac and cheese. Choosing the wrong depth is how you end up with dried-out edges and cold centers.
Choose the Lid for the Labor
It's easy to dismiss a lid as just a lid. In a high-traffic buffet, the lid choice impacts both labor cost and guest experience.
Lift-Off Lids
The traditional choice. Cost-effective, easy to store. The logistics problem: where does the guest or server put the dripping, hot lid once it's removed? Without a dedicated lid person or lid stands, you end up with grease rings and water marks on linen-draped tables. Fine for budget setups or short events.
Roll-Top Lids
The gold standard for high-end catering. The lid stays attached to the frame and rolls back smoothly. Two operational wins: the lid is never misplaced or set down on a dirty surface, and guests can serve themselves more easily — which means you can run a buffet with fewer manned stations. For a wedding caterer running 200+ guest events, that labor savings pays back the lid premium inside three or four jobs.
Catering Pans and Food Pan Strategy
Catering pans (also called hotel pans or steam-table pans) are the workhorse vessels that nest inside your chafer water pans. The same pan you used to prep vegetables in the walk-in this morning fits inside the chafer at service, then drops back into the dish pit. This "prep-to-serve" workflow drastically cuts the number of dishes you wash and the labor required to plate.
Stock your catering equipment in mixed sizes so you can adapt to any menu — full pans for the main entree, halves for two side dishes, thirds for sauces and toppings. Pans with tapered sides nest inside one another and dramatically reduce shelf space. The mix-and-match flexibility is what separates a catering setup that scales from one that gets cornered every time the menu changes.

Pricing Tiers and Where the Dollars Go
Chafing dish prices range from $20 to over $2,000. The spread comes down to material, size, and heat source.
| Tier | Price Range | What You Get |
|---|---|---|
| Disposable aluminum sets | Under $10 | Single-use, drop-off catering, lightweight transport |
| Standard stainless | $40 - $200 | Commercial-grade workhorses for daily use |
| Premium and electric | $200 - $500 | Roll-top lids, electric heating, induction-ready |
| Specialty and high-end | $500 - $2,000+ | Designer finishes, integrated burners, brand-name aesthetic for upscale events |

Setup Checklist
- Place the frame on a flat, stable, heat-resistant surface. Keep it away from busy walkways and outdoor wind exposure.
- Fill the water pan with 1 to 1.25 inches of hot or boiling water.
- Insert the food pan, ensuring its base sits just above the water line — not in the water.
- Verify food is already at or above 140°F before placing it in the food pan.
- Light the fuel with a long-handled lighter, or switch on the electric/induction unit.
- Place the lid on. Trap the steam.
- Spot-check food temperature with a thermometer every 30 minutes. Spot-check water level every 45-60 minutes.
Cleaning and Maintenance
A "dry-burned" chafer is a nightmare to clean and can permanently discolor stainless steel. If a water pan runs dry while fuel is still burning, the heat bakes residue into the metal, creating burn-on that's nearly impossible to remove with standard detergents.
Post-Event Routine
- Snuff the fuel and let the entire unit cool fully before cleaning. A hot water pan and metal frame are serious burn risks.
- Discard leftover food and pour cooled water into the trash — never down the drain (grease causes plumbing issues).
- Wash food pans, water pans, and lids with warm soapy water. Most 304 stainless components are dishwasher-safe — verify with manufacturer instructions.
- Hand-wipe outer frames and lid surfaces with a soft microfiber cloth and a dedicated stainless steel polish.
- Avoid abrasive green scrubbies on polished surfaces. They leave micro-scratches that dull the finish over time and create pits where bacteria can collect.
- Dry every component immediately. Trapped moisture during storage causes water spots, mineral buildup, and eventual rust on lower-grade alloys.

Smart Storage
Storage is where chafers either survive a decade of service or get destroyed in eighteen months. Before storing, every component must be bone-dry — any trapped moisture leads to rust or mildew, especially over long off-season periods.
Stack components logically: place the food pan inside the water pan, set both inside the inverted frame, and place the lid on top. This nested approach saves shelf space and prevents dents and scratches between uses. Store in a clean, dry area away from direct moisture exposure.

Common Mistakes to Avoid
- Cold water in the water pan. Always start hot. Saves fuel and gets you to safe holding temperature 20+ minutes faster.
- Skipping the wind guard outdoors. Even a light breeze drops your steam temperature below safe-hold inside 30 minutes.
- Reheating cold leftovers in the chafer. Parks food in the danger zone. This is a food safety violation, not just a quality issue.
- Overcrowding the food pan. Heat can't circulate. Center stays cold while edges scorch.
- Letting the water pan run dry. The single fastest way to destroy a chafer permanently.
- Buying 400-series steel to save $30. You'll replace the chafer in 18 months. The "savings" become a recurring expense.
- Forgetting backup fuel. One missed canister swap can drop a buffet below safe-hold and end an event.
Frequently Asked Questions
What's the difference between a full, half, and 2/3 size chafing dish?
Full-size chafers hold 8-9 quarts in a 12 x 20 inch food pan. Half-size hold 4-5 quarts in a 10 x 12 inch pan. 2/3 size hold 5-6 quarts. Full-size is the workhorse for entrees and large gatherings; half and 2/3 sizes work for sides, sauces, or when you need menu variety in a tight buffet footprint.
Can I cook food directly in a chafing dish?
No. A chafer is a holding station, not a stove. The gentle steam isn't powerful enough to cook raw ingredients to a safe internal temperature, and any attempt to do so parks food inside the bacterial danger zone for far too long. Always cook food fully — to 165°F internal for poultry, 145°F for whole cuts, 155°F for ground meats — before it goes into the chafer.
How much water should I put in the water pan?
1 to 1.25 inches. Use hot or boiling water at setup. Top off with hot water every 45-60 minutes during long events. Too little water scorches the pan; too much soaks the food pan from below and ruins texture.
How long does chafing fuel actually last?
Standard canisters burn 2-6 hours depending on type. Wick fuels burn longer and more consistently — the right call for weddings and full-day events. Gel fuels burn hotter but shorter. Always check the manufacturer label for stated burn time and carry at least one extra canister per chafer.
Why does the stainless steel grade matter?
Type 304 stainless is non-porous, corrosion-resistant, and stands up to commercial dishwashers and the heat-cool cycle without warping. Cheaper 400-series alloys pit and rust in steam-table moisture inside one or two seasons. The price difference is small. The longevity difference is years.
Roll-top vs lift-off lid — which should I buy?
Roll-top if you're running high-volume catering or upscale events. The lid never gets misplaced, the buffet looks cleaner, and guests can serve themselves more easily so you need fewer staff at the line. Lift-off if you're running budget setups or short events where lid logistics aren't a problem. The labor savings on roll-tops typically pays back the price premium in three or four jobs.
Do I need a wind guard outdoors?
Yes — every time, no exceptions. Even a light breeze blows out fuel flames or dissipates heat fast enough that the water pan never reaches steaming temperature. Without a wind guard, your buffet drops below safe-hold inside an hour and you've got a food safety problem.
Is electric or induction worth the higher upfront cost?
For venue-based caterers running multiple events per week, yes — induction usually pays back inside year one through fuel savings, lower fire-risk insurance, and precise temperature control. For mobile or outdoor caterers, fuel-based chafers are still essential because power outlets aren't guaranteed.
How do I prevent food from drying out or sticking?
Keep the lid closed between servings to trap moisture. Lightly coat the food pan with oil or non-stick spray for items prone to sticking. Stir occasionally during service to redistribute moisture and heat. For fried items prone to sogginess, use a vented lid that lets steam escape.
How do I prevent dry-burn damage?
Check the water level every 45-60 minutes during service. Top off with hot water before the pan runs dry. If a pan does run dry and you spot it, kill the fuel immediately and let the unit cool fully before adding water — adding water to a hot dry pan can crack metal and creates a dangerous steam burst.
What's the right way to store chafers between events?
Bone-dry every component before storage. Nest the food pan inside the water pan, place both inside the inverted frame, and set the lid on top. Store in a clean, dry space away from moisture. Trapped water during storage is the leading cause of rust on lower-grade alloys.
